Common Mistakes and Myths

Many people think that code reviews are the only way to catch mistakes in software. While they are important, relying solely on them can lead to missed issues. It’s crucial to have other checkers, like verifiers and critics, involved in the process to ensure a well-rounded review.

Another common myth is that only senior developers can provide valuable feedback. In reality, fresh perspectives from less experienced team members can uncover problems and spark new ideas. Everyone’s input matters, and fostering a culture of open communication can strengthen the whole team.

Comparison of Approaches for Beyond Code Reviews: Verifiers and Critics as Required Checkers

Topic When to Use Pros Cons Complexity Cost
Peer Review Use when team members can share knowledge effectively. Encourages collaboration, Improves code quality Can be time-consuming, May lead to conflicts medium low
Pair Programming Use when tackling complex problems that need teamwork. Real-time feedback, Fosters learning Requires constant communication, Can be draining high medium
Code Audits Use for a thorough review of existing codebases. Identifies hidden issues, Provides a fresh perspective Can be expensive, May disrupt workflow high high
Continuous Integration Use when you want to catch errors early in the development cycle. Automates testing, Speeds up delivery Requires setup effort, Can lead to false positives medium medium
